if you are a prediabetic, diabetic or person who is gaining weight without eating much you will be having insulin resistance, you should undergo following tests.

  1. Insulin response test—fasting, 1-hour, and 2-hour glucose and insulin levels after a 75-gram glucose load. This is like a glucose tolerance test but measures both glucose andinsulin. Your blood sugar can be normal but your insulin can be sky high. discuss with your Doctor regarding insulin levels also.
  2. Oral Glucose Tolerance Test – The oral glucose tolerance test (OGTT) measures the body’s ability to use a type of sugar, called glucose, that is the body’s main source of energy. An OGTT can be used to diagnose prediabetes and diabetes, Fasting reading should be less than 100mg/dl , post 1 hr should be < 184mg/dl and post 2 hr shall be <140mg/dl.
  3. HBA1C  Test which shows your 3 months average of blood sugar levels
  4. Lipid panel— total cholesterol (ideal < 180 mg/dl), LDL (ideal < 70 mg/dl), HDL cholesterol (ideal > 60 mg/dl), and triglycerides (ideal < 100 mg/dl).

If your HBA1C is more than 7 :

HBA1C will indicate average blood suagr levels for the last 3 months, its pretty well a good indicator to measure your blood glucose levels, if you want to reverse insulin resistance 100% than you should target for a HBA1c below 5.4 % .  Diabetics generally have HBA1C in between 6 – 7% . You need to monitor your blood sugar levels more often, its time to buy a blood glucose meter and monitor your blood sugar levels more frequently to understand which foods are spiking your blood sugar levels and eliminate or minimise intake of such foods.
